Jeevan Bikas Laghubitta Bittiya Sanstha Limited is issuing 19,77,300 units worth Rs 19.77 crore as Initial Public Offering to the general public from Ashad 11, 2078. The early closing date of this issue is on Ashad 15 and if the issue is not fully subscribed till Ashad 15, then it can be extended up to Ashad 25, 2078. , Jeevan bikas laghubitta share price is Rs100 per share in Initial Public Offering (IPO).
A total of the offered 19,77,300 units; 0.5%, 30,420 units have been set aside for the staff of the company and 5%, 98,865 units have been set aside for the mutual funds. The remaining 18,48,015 units are for the general public. NMB Capital Limited has been appointed as the issue manager for the IPO. Applicants can be placed for a minimum of 10 units and a maximum of 1,000 units.

About Jeevan Vikas Laghubitta
Jeevan Vikas Microfinance Financial Institution Limited, promoted by Jeevan Vikas Samaj (Non-Governmental Organization), has been providing financial services since March 3, 2008 by obtaining a license from Nepal Rastra Bank as a “D” class (national level) financial institution. Pursuant to the Regulations on Merger and Acquisition of Banks and Financial Institutions issued by Nepal Rastra Bank, 2077, this financial institution and the Self Microfinance Financial Institution Ltd. Dhankuta and Poverty Reduction Microfinance Financial Institution Ltd. The merger has been completed and the integrated transaction has started on September 7, 2008.
Moving forward with the main goal of building a poverty-free Nepal, this financial institution has been providing various services to uplift the living standards of poor families in rural areas. Currently, 293,000 families have directly benefited from the 138 branch offices of this financial institution. With the intention of minimizing economic inequality and expanding the facilities available in the city to the rural areas, this financial institution is providing various types of financial services (savings, loans, insurance and remittances). The financial institution is working in the fields of education, health, agriculture, energy, employment development, etc. with the support and cooperation of the concerned agencies as per its annual plan.
For the development and promotion of cashless banking services, the financial institution is expanding its financial services in the rural areas in a simple and easy way by motivating the members towards digital business.
